Tachidesk Sorayomi
Tachidesk Sorayomi is a free, open-source manga reader designed to connect with a local Tachidesk server. It offers a sleek interface for reading self-hosted manga collections, appealing to users with their own manga servers.
Reads manga from a Tachidesk-Server instance, providing a local manga reading experience.
Pros
- + Free and open-source under MPL-2.0 license.
- + Cross-platform support, including macOS.
- + Unique ability to connect with a local manga server.
Cons
- - No auto-update feature.
- - Niche appeal limits community support.
RustDesk
RustDesk is an open-source remote desktop application designed as a self-hosted alternative to TeamViewer. It offers secure, cross-platform remote access and control, making it ideal for users seeking privacy and flexibility.
Enables remote access and control of other computers, providing a secure and efficient alternative to proprietary solutions.
Pros
- + Open-source and self-hostable, ensuring privacy and control
- + Written in Rust, offering performance and security advantages
- + Active and large community with high GitHub engagement
- + Regular updates and strong development activity
Cons
- - No auto-update feature
- - Potential privacy concerns with Chinese root certificates
